numpy.distutils.ccompiler_opt.CCompilerOpt.feature_untied#

метод

distutils.ccompiler_opt.CCompilerOpt.feature_untied(names)[источник]#

то же, что и 'feature_ahead()', но если обе функции подразумевали друг друга и сохраняют наивысший интерес.

Параметры:
‘names’: последовательность

последовательность имён функций CPU в верхнем регистре.

Возвращает:
список функций CPU, отсортированный как есть 'names'

Примеры

>>> self.feature_untied(["SSE2", "SSE3", "SSE41"])
["SSE2", "SSE3", "SSE41"]
# assume AVX2 and FMA3 implies each other
>>> self.feature_untied(["SSE2", "SSE3", "SSE41", "FMA3", "AVX2"])
["SSE2", "SSE3", "SSE41", "AVX2"]